Research Interests
From my earlier experience in robotics hardware, I’ve learned that I am enthusiastic about working at the intersection of machine design and electrical systems design. I aspire to conduct research in this technical context by seeking impactful applications in energy and sustainability. My past M.S. work at UC Berkeley focused on developing fish-inspired robotic systems for coral reef sampling and health monitoring. Currently I’m interested in leveraging my experience with electrical systems and controls for the GEAR Energy team.
